GIA’s holiday drive supports Dress for Success San Diego and It’s All About the Kids

CARLSBAD, Calif. – 21 December 2015 – GIA (Gemological Institute of America) staff and students in Carlsbad are helping brighten the holiday season for San Diegans in need, donating hundreds of toys, clothing, cosmetics and nearly $1,000 to two local charities as part of its annual Holiday Gift Drive. The Institute collected nearly 1,000 items for Dress for Success San Diego, a non-profit that provides a network of support, professional attire and development tools to help women achieve economic independence and thrive in work and in life; and nearly 250 items for It’s All About the Kids®, a non-profit foundation that supports local children’s charities.
 
Among the nearly 1,000 items donated to Dress for Success San Diego were professional attire, accessories and cosmetics. "We are honoured to be chosen as one of the beneficiaries of GIA’s annual Holiday Gift Drive. These donations will brighten the holiday season and provide a confidence boost to our clients as they enter the workforce,” said Sylvia Evans-McKinney, founder and executive director of Dress for Success San Diego.
 
Among the nearly 250 items donated to the It’s All About the Kids Foundation were playpens, learning toys and puzzles, soft toy animals and athletics gear. “Thank you to the wonderful women and men of GIA for their amazing generosity. With their help, we have been able to surpass our goal of making the holidays bright for over 1,600 children this year,” said Angela Brannon-Baptiste, co-founder and president of the board for It’s All About the Kids Foundation.   
 
Dress for Success San Diego is a non-profit organisation focused exclusively on empowering disadvantaged women to compete for jobs, build careers and improve the quality of life for their families. At its boutique, staff and volunteers provide private consultations, interview coaching and apparel, technology resources, and employment retention and career building programmes. Dress for Success San Diego has served nearly 9,000 local women since 1998, referred from more than 60 social service agency partners.
 
It’s All About the Kids Foundation is a non-profit organisation that creates new and innovative programmes to benefit children’s charities and enhance the lives of less fortunate children and their families. The foundation is committed to the advancement of children through the joining of music, the arts and the generosity of corporations and individuals. In all, It’s All About the Kids collects toys for more than 1,600 children in San Diego and Baja Mexico. 
 
GIA’s New York campus is getting into the spirit of the season as well, working with Toys for Tots, a non-profit programme organised by the U.S. Marine Corps Reserve, which collects and distributes toys to children whose parents are unable to afford them. They are also conducting a coat drive for New York Cares, the city’s largest volunteer management organisation that runs programmes for 1,300 non-profits, city agencies and public schools. 

GIA’s annual Holiday Gift Drive has supported local charities since 1996. For more details about the Institute, visit GIA.edu

About GIA

An independent non-profit organisation, GIA (Gemological Institute of America), established in 1931, is recognised as the world’s foremost authority in gemmology. GIA invented the famous 4Cs of Colour, Cut, Clarity and Carat Weight in the early 1950s and, in 1953, created the International Diamond Grading System™ which today is recognised by virtually every professional jeweller in the world.
 
Through research, education, gemmological laboratory services and instrument development, the Institute is dedicated to ensuring the public trust in gems and jewellery by upholding the highest standards of integrity, academics, science and professionalism.
